Output 315d4e05a82b374dbe51b24f137ea576581a9aafef52af4c9dc951229fcd03d1:1

value
676807740
script pubkey
OP_0 OP_PUSHBYTES_20 896bb394974f07d4bffd09ef2668d00bc013bf07
address
bc1q394m89yhfuraf0lap8hjv6xsp0qp80c87du6u2
transaction
315d4e05a82b374dbe51b24f137ea576581a9aafef52af4c9dc951229fcd03d1
confirmations
364038
spent
true